Struct stripe::PaymentMethodUsBankAccount
source · [−]pub struct PaymentMethodUsBankAccount {
pub account_holder_type: Option<PaymentMethodUsBankAccountAccountHolderType>,
pub account_type: Option<PaymentMethodUsBankAccountAccountType>,
pub bank_name: Option<String>,
pub financial_connections_account: Option<String>,
pub fingerprint: Option<String>,
pub last4: Option<String>,
pub networks: Option<UsBankAccountNetworks>,
pub routing_number: Option<String>,
}
Fields
account_holder_type: Option<PaymentMethodUsBankAccountAccountHolderType>
Account holder type: individual or company.
account_type: Option<PaymentMethodUsBankAccountAccountType>
Account type: checkings or savings.
Defaults to checking if omitted.
bank_name: Option<String>
The name of the bank.
financial_connections_account: Option<String>
The ID of the Financial Connections Account used to create the payment method.
fingerprint: Option<String>
Uniquely identifies this particular bank account.
You can use this attribute to check whether two bank accounts are the same.
last4: Option<String>
Last four digits of the bank account number.
networks: Option<UsBankAccountNetworks>
Contains information about US bank account networks that can be used.
routing_number: Option<String>
Routing number of the bank account.
Trait Implementations
sourceimpl Clone for PaymentMethodUsBankAccount
impl Clone for PaymentMethodUsBankAccount
sourcefn clone(&self) -> PaymentMethodUsBankAccount
fn clone(&self) -> PaymentMethodUsBankAccount
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
sourceimpl Debug for PaymentMethodUsBankAccount
impl Debug for PaymentMethodUsBankAccount
sourceimpl Default for PaymentMethodUsBankAccount
impl Default for PaymentMethodUsBankAccount
sourcefn default() -> PaymentMethodUsBankAccount
fn default() -> PaymentMethodUsBankAccount
Returns the “default value” for a type. Read more
sourceimpl<'de> Deserialize<'de> for PaymentMethodUsBankAccount
impl<'de> Deserialize<'de> for PaymentMethodUsBankAccount
sourcefn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ations
impl RefUnwindSafe for PaymentMethodUsBankAccount
impl Send for PaymentMethodUsBankAccount
impl Sync for PaymentMethodUsBankAccount
impl Unpin for PaymentMethodUsBankAccount
impl UnwindSafe for PaymentMethodUsBankAccount
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
sourceimpl<T> Instrument for T
impl<T> Instrument for T
sourcefn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
sourcefn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
impl<V, T> VZip<V> for T where
V: MultiLane<T>,
impl<V, T> VZip<V> for T where
V: MultiLane<T>,
fn vzip(self) -> V
sourceimpl<T> WithSubscriber for T
impl<T> WithSubscriber for T
sourcefn with_subscriber<S>(self, subscriber: S) -> WithDispatch<Self> where
S: Into<Dispatch>,
fn with_subscriber<S>(self, subscriber: S) -> WithDispatch<Self> where
S: Into<Dispatch>,
Attaches the provided Subscriber
to this type, returning a
WithDispatch
wrapper. Read more
sourcefn with_current_subscriber(self) -> WithDispatch<Self>
fn with_current_subscriber(self) -> WithDispatch<Self>
Attaches the current default Subscriber
to this type, returning a
WithDispatch
wrapper. Read more